Welding Wire for Gas Protective Welding of Reduced Activation Martensitic/Ferritic Steel and Method of Manufacturing the Same
Welding wire for gas protective welding of reduced activation ferritic/martensitic steel and the manufacturing method, chemical components (weight percentage, wt %): C: 0.10.15, Cr: 8.09.0, W: 1.01.6, V: 0.150.25, Ta: 0.100.17, Mn: 0.500.70, Si: 00.05, N: 00.02, O, Ni, Cu, Al, and Co: 00.01 respectively, P, S, Ag, Mo, and Nb: 00.005 respectively, and balance of Fe. The welding wire has Cr equivalent weight of less than 11, Ni equivalent weight of greater than 3.5. It is manufactured with a wire rod through multi-pass drawing. The rod is subject to annealing heat treatment, tempering treatment performed between the passes of drawing. The annealing process is: the rod is at 9401020 for 2060 minutes, and the n cooled to below 650 C. at rate of less than 45 C./hour, air-cooled to room temperature. The tempering process is: the rod is at 760820 for 0.52 hours. It reduces forming of ferrites in welded joints.
